Abstract:
Abstract To understand postmodernismpostmodernism’s impact on entrepreneurshipentrepreneurship, it is vital to understand that informationinformation is the lowest common denominatorlowest common denominator for all those who aspire to be entrepreneurs. No one can be a consistently effective entrepreneur without it. Yet, the advent of postmodernism may change how entrepreneurs can access and view information. Postmodernismpostmodernism could change entrepreneurship to such an extent that it could no longer be a primary driver of wealthwealth creation nor a solution to many of the world’s most pressing problems.
